How do you apply for a construction permit in a rural area in the DR?

To request a construction permit in a rural area in the Dominican Republic, you must go to the Urban Planning Office of the corresponding locality. You must submit construction plans, technical specifications and other necessary documents. The local authority will review the application and, if approved, issue the building permit.

What is de facto guardianship and how is it established in Guatemala?

De facto custody in Guatemala refers to the situation in which a person assumes responsibility and care for a minor without legal authorization or a court ruling. De facto custody is established through the will and agreement of the parties involved, and does not have solid legal support. It is recommended to seek legal regulation to protect the rights and well-being of the minor.

How is the technical suitability of contractors verified in Costa Rica?

The technical suitability of contractors in Costa Rica is verified through the presentation of documentation that supports their experience, technical capacity and resources to carry out construction projects. This may include references, certifications, and evidence of previous successful projects.
